The Importance of Cybersecurity in Today’s World

The Importance of Cybersecurity in Today’s World

In our increasingly digital and connected world, cybersecurity has become a critical concern for individuals, businesses, and governments alike. With the rise of cyber threats and the potential for devastating consequences, it is essential that we prioritize the protection of our digital assets and personal information.

One of the main reasons why cybersecurity is so important is the prevalence of cyber attacks. Hackers and cybercriminals are constantly evolving their tactics and finding new ways to exploit vulnerabilities in computer systems and networks. These attacks can range from stealing sensitive data and financial information to disrupting critical infrastructure and causing widespread damage.

The Risks of Cyber Attacks

The risks associated with cyber attacks are multifaceted and can have far-reaching consequences. For individuals, a cyber attack can result in identity theft, financial loss, and damage to personal reputation. For businesses, the impact can be even more severe, with potential losses of sensitive customer data, intellectual property, and financial resources.

In addition to the financial and reputational damage, cyber attacks can also pose a threat to national security. Governments and organizations responsible for critical infrastructure, such as power grids and transportation systems, are particularly vulnerable to cyber attacks. A successful attack on these systems could have catastrophic consequences for public safety and national security.

Protecting Against Cyber Threats

Given the high stakes involved, it is crucial that individuals and organizations take proactive measures to protect themselves against cyber threats. Here are some essential steps to enhance cybersecurity:

  1. Implement Strong Passwords: Use unique and complex passwords for all your online accounts and change them regularly.
  2. Enable Two-Factor Authentication: Add an extra layer of security by requiring a second form of verification, such as a fingerprint or a code sent to your mobile device.
  3. Keep Software Up to Date: Regularly update your operating systems, antivirus software, and other applications to ensure they have the latest security patches.
  4. Be Cautious of Phishing Attempts: Be wary of suspicious emails, messages, or phone calls that ask for personal information or financial details. Avoid clicking on suspicious links or downloading attachments from unknown sources.
  5. Use a Virtual Private Network (VPN): A VPN encrypts your internet connection, making it more secure and protecting your online activities from prying eyes.

It is also important to stay informed about the latest cybersecurity threats and trends. Regularly educate yourself and your employees about best practices for online safety and encourage a culture of cybersecurity awareness.

The Future of Cybersecurity

As technology continues to advance, so too will the sophistication of cyber threats. It is crucial that we stay one step ahead by investing in advanced cybersecurity measures and fostering a culture of vigilance and preparedness.

Emerging technologies such as artificial intelligence and blockchain have the potential to revolutionize cybersecurity by offering new ways to detect and prevent cyber attacks. However, these technologies also present new challenges and vulnerabilities that need to be addressed.

In conclusion, cybersecurity is a paramount concern in today’s world. By taking proactive steps to protect ourselves and our digital assets, we can mitigate the risks posed by cyber threats and ensure a safer and more secure digital future.
